Concentration via chaining method and its applications

In this paper we study the regularity of paths in terms of properties of admissible nets. We show the right concentration inequality above the modulus of continuity. Using the approach we prove the Bernstein type inequality for the empirical processes. Therefore we obtain the best form of concentration for processes studied recently by Mendelson and Paouris. Results of this type are of importance in the compressed sensing theory.
